Your Ducts Move Your Home's Entire Air Supply — Every Day

Everything your household generates — dust, skin cells, pet dander, cooking aerosols, pollen pulled in from outside — cycles through your ductwork several times a day. Over years, it settles into a lining of debris along supply runs, return trunks, and the plenum around your air handler. Add a humid Baltimore summer and that lining holds moisture — which is why so many systems exhale a musty note the moment the AC starts. Renovation dust, rodent activity, and smoke after a fire accelerate the buildup dramatically.

H&H cleans the system the way the job is meant to be done: source-removal cleaning under negative pressure. A high-powered vacuum collection unit connects to your trunk line and puts the entire duct network under suction, registers are sealed, and rotating brushes and agitation tools dislodge debris so it travels one direction:

Dislodged debrisbrushed loose in-duct
Under suctionone direction only
Out of your homeinto our collection unit

It's the same containment thinking we apply to mold remediation and water damage restoration across Baltimore: capture contamination, don't scatter it.

Signs Your Ductwork Needs Cleaning

If any of these sound like your home, your ducts are recirculating more than clean air.

Dust Returns Fast

Back within a day of cleaning, or puffs visibly from vents when the system starts.

Musty or Stale Odor

A smell whenever heating or cooling runs — moisture in the duct lining.

Indoor Allergy Flare-Ups

Respiratory symptoms indoors that ease when you leave the house.

Visible Grille Buildup

Matted gray lint on register grilles or inside the duct opening means the run is coated.

Weak or Uneven Airflow

Room-to-room imbalance, or energy bills creeping up as the system strains.

After a Major Event

Renovations, water damage, smoke, or rodent activity load ducts far faster than daily life.

Newly Bought Older Home

An older Baltimore home with no record of the ducts ever being cleaned.

How often should ducts be cleaned?
Every few years for a typical home, sooner with shedding pets, allergies, smokers, or recent renovations — and promptly after water damage, fire, or rodent activity, which contaminate ducts fast. Our inspection tells you honestly whether yours are due or can wait.

Will duct cleaning help my allergies?
If your ducts are coated with dander, dust-mite debris, and pollen, removing that reservoir means the system stops redistributing allergens every cycle — and many households notice the difference quickly. It's one piece of the indoor-air puzzle alongside filtration and humidity control, and we'll tell you honestly if your ducts aren't the culprit.
